Abstract :

Castleman�s disease was fi rst described by Dr. Benjamin Castleman in 1956. It is a benign and rare lymphoproliferative disorder. Th e two main forms are unicentric and multicentric Castleman�s disease. In HIV positive patients, available evidence points to HHV8 as the cause of multicentric Castleman�s disease. Th e synergism of HIV and HHV8 causes a number of common HIV associated diseases which may pose diagnostic challenges. In addition, HIV associated multicentric Castleman�s disease poses management challenges. Th is presentation discusses some of these challenges, specifi cally as relevant to Sub-Saharan Africa, in the light of current research questions about HIV and HHV8.
